There's nothing I can do about handing in a blank math test this week...
In fact, you can guess on multiple-choice questions, but for Chen Shi'an, guessing right or wrong makes no difference.
Instead of worrying about how many points you can get on the weekly test, you should take advantage of the time while everyone else is doing the weekly test to continue learning his junior high school math.
When the bell rang to signal the end of evening self-study, Chen Shi'an took out a few milk candies, placed them on the desk of the class monitor who was watching him, and quickly slipped away.
back home.
The air was filled with the sweet aroma of mung bean soup, but this time it had a slightly stronger flavor of dog liver compared to the last time.
Unlike wild mushrooms, wild vegetables can be stored in the refrigerator for a while. Since she had some free time after get off work, Li Wanyin used these wild vegetables to cook a pot of mung bean sweet soup with the taste of her childhood.
"Did Sister Wanyin make mung bean soup?"
"Yes, it's ready to eat after cooling down a bit."
Chen Shi'an always arrived home on time, almost always exactly 10 o'clock. Over time, this became a daily biological clock point for Li Wanyin.
She would finish showering and doing laundry before 10 o'clock so as not to fight for the bathroom after he came back. If she wanted to cook something, she would make sure the sweet soup was ready just as he returned.
Because of their different time zones, Chen Shi'an had never seen Li Wanyin leave for work or come home from get off work. It was as if he had the illusion that she stayed at home all day.
The two sat down at the table, and Chen Shi'an picked up the bowl of lukewarm mung bean soup and slurped a mouthful.
"Delicious."
Chen Shi'an nodded and said, "Sister Wanyin probably picked out the stems of the dog liver vegetable after it was cooked, right?"
"You even know that!"
"Yes, you can tell the difference. The taste is quite different when you boil only the leaves versus when you boil them with the stems. The stems have a stronger cooling effect. When I cook them myself, I boil them together and then pick them out later."
"Your tongue is amazing..."
Li Wanyin admired it and took a bite herself. "I can't really taste the difference, but my mom has always cooked it this way."
"How was Wanyin's work today?" Chen Shi'an asked curiously.
"feel good."
Li Wanyin got up to get her backpack, then took out a work badge to show him.
"what is this?"
"Employee badge, that's what you wear when you're at the company."
Chen Shi'an curiously picked up her employee badge and examined it. It was a style that hung around her neck, and inside was just a paper card with the company name and her job information printed on it, along with a one-inch photo of her.
The one-inch photo has a blue background. I don't know when Li Wanyin took it. She is sitting very upright, smiling, and wearing a very professional white shirt.
Chen Shi'an looked at the photo, then at Li Wanyin in front of him, blinked, and seemed to be smiling.
Seeing that he kept staring at the photo, Li Wanyin felt embarrassed and reached out to take her employee ID card away, not letting him see it.
"When was this photo of Sister Wanyin taken?"
"It was a few months ago. I took these photos specifically so I could put them on my resume when looking for a job."
"You look very professional. I've never seen you wear that white shirt before."
"Hehe, I'm not used to wearing it. I bought one specifically in case I needed it, but I only wore it for the photoshoot..."
"Does your company require employees to wear any kind of uniform or similar work attire?"
"No need for that. Just wear normal clothes. The sales staff at the company will require you to wear a suit."
This was Li Wanyin's first official job and her first day at work, so naturally she had a lot of feelings to share. She also took a lot of photos, and seeing that Chen Shi'an was interested, she took out her phone to show him.
There are many photos, such as the office environment, her own workstation, and the fast food she ate for lunch today.
The backpack also contained a notebook and pen with the company logo printed on them, which is provided to every new employee.
Chen Shi'an opened her notebook, which contained her neat handwriting, recording her work content, precautions, and key points for new employee training.
She also joined the company's work group and installed an app called Dingding. Li Wanyin opened the app to show him how to clock in and how to submit an application report if she needed to ask for leave.
Chen Shi'an had never worked a regular job, but these changes had affected Li Wanyin, and he couldn't help but sigh, "It seems that Sister Wanyin is now a real office worker."
"Haha, yeah, I feel like I'm starting to smell like a classmate."
What does "class flavor" taste like?
"The unique flavor of working-class people!"
Chen Shi'an was taken aback for a moment, then realized what he meant and asked with a smile, "Is Sister Wanyin busy with work today?"
"Today was alright, mostly training and learning. This week will be the same. There will be training and assessment later. Only after passing the assessment will you be officially employed. Then there will be a one-month probation period, followed by another assessment to determine your eligibility and performance rating."
"Sister Wanyin, are you confident?"
"Of course!"
"Then Wanyin, keep up the good work and get your job settled as soon as possible. You can work during the day and set up a stall at night to experience being your own boss."
Hearing Chen Shi'an's words, Li Wanyin chuckled. "Getting a stable job early so you can set up a stall? What kind of career path is that?"
Although it was her first day at work and there wasn't much to do, it was still a new environment and new things to experience, so Li Wanyin was inevitably a little tired. However, after sharing her experience with Chen Shi'an, she became full of energy again.
Chen Shi'an went to take a shower, and Li Wanyin didn't go back to her room either. Instead, she took the training materials she brought back from the company and sat cross-legged on the sofa to read them.
After taking a shower, Chen Shi'an sat down on the sofa.
The three-seater sofa had Fei Mo occupying one seat, Li Wanyin sitting in the middle, and Chen Shi'an sitting on the left. The space wasn't exactly crowded, but it still exceeded the usual social distancing guidelines.
The floor fan in the living room blew air from Chen Shi'an's side, bringing with it the refreshing scent of his shower.
Li Wanyin, who was looking at the training materials, was distracted for a moment. She reached out her finger and gently tucked the strands of hair that had been ruffled by the wind behind her ear.
Chen Shi'an brought over a plate of washed grapes. Uncle Lin had given them a lot of fruit that day, and they couldn't finish it all. When he wasn't around, Li Wanyin was too embarrassed to eat them herself, so he always had to urge her to eat them.
The two ate grapes one by one, while Chen Shi'an looked down and turned on his phone.
Several more friend requests appeared on my WeChat, all from my classmates.
Now that he's the class's psychology representative, his classmates seem rather reserved, and so far no one has come forward to tell him about their difficulties.
Remembering the Douyin post he made that morning, Chen Shi'an opened Douyin and took a look.
To his surprise, the "mountain-chasing photo series" on Douyin actually got quite a few likes. The account only had a little over 8,000 followers, but this video already had over 600 likes and quite a few comments.
Some asked him where he picked the wild mushrooms, some asked him how he cooked them, and others asked him what the pine cones were for.
Now that there was WiFi at home, Chen Shi'an thought for a moment and then uploaded the video of making pine nut candy that Li Wanyin had sent him last night.
[The first thing to do is to make the syrup...]
[You continue! I'll record a video so I can learn to do it myself later...]
As the familiar voice rang out in the video, Li Wanyin turned her head and curiously leaned over to take a look.
"Shi'an, did you post the video on Douyin?"
"Yeah, just sharing whatever comes to mind."
"That's pretty good! You have over 8,000 followers on Douyin now. Like your PE teacher, you can share some fun content and earn some pocket money. I saw the mountain-chasing photos you posted this morning, and they seemed to get a lot of likes."
"Hey, did Sister Wanyin see it too?"
"I've followed you."
Li Wanyin put down the training materials in her hand and opened her Douyin account.
Without her even having to click on it, big data directly pushed the video of Chen Shi'an making pine nut candy that she had just posted to her interface, with a [Special Attention] icon next to it.
Li Wanyin was quick-witted and immediately liked the video that Chen Shi'an had just posted.
"Special attention? Sister Wanyin is paying that much attention to me?"
"...Haha! I just wanted to see what you usually post!"
"Which Douyin account is Wanyin's? I'll follow you too."
"I rarely post on Douyin..."
"Which one?"
"Even Douyin friends aren't very useful..."
"Which one?"
Chen Shi'an seemed oblivious to her polite refusal and continued to press for answers.
Seeing that he insisted, Li Wanyin had no choice but to tell him the Douyin number.
Chen Shi'an searched and found a list of users named [Little Echo].
He didn't even need to ask Li Wanyin which one was her, because the first one in the list was the same profile picture that Li Wanyin used on WeChat before. Her WeChat profile picture was now a riverside photo that Chen Shi'an took for her, while Douyin was still using the old one.
"Let me take a good look at what Sister Wanyin usually posts—"
"..."
Li Wanyin was certain that Chen Shi'an had said those words on purpose!
Give your sister some privacy, you know!
Even if you want to see, you can go back to your room and peek secretly, but don't keep peeking in front of people like this!
As online social platforms, places like Douyin and Xiaohongshu often prioritize 'privacy' more than WeChat Moments.
Humans are so strange. Many people are afraid that their family and friends will know about certain things, but they don't mind strangers knowing about them; while some people don't mind their friends and family knowing about certain things, but are afraid that strangers will know about them.
In modern society, if you have friends on two or more social media platforms besides QQ and WeChat, then you are truly a close friend.
The only purpose of having friends on Douyin is not for chatting, but for tagging others when you find a funny video.
Ever since Li Wanyin made that statement in the group that she wanted to get rich quickly and support a male high school student, she now receives several system notifications every day from her best friends tagging her to watch male high school students... Chen Shi'an is the first and only male friend that Li Wanyin has on both WeChat and Douyin.
Fortunately, Chen Shi'an only saw the [Little Echo] account information on his phone. Otherwise, if he had seen those videos that his girlfriends usually shared, he would definitely have thought that something was wrong with his sister. Would she have wanted to watch those videos?
"Sister Wanyin has posted so many Douyin videos, and she said she rarely posts them."
"..."
Chen Shi'an was somewhat surprised when he saw the more than thirty Douyin videos on [Xiao Huiyin]'s profile.
He casually clicked on the first piece of work.
It was a work published on May 23rd of this year.
The content is a song.
A song sung by Li Wanyin herself.
The interface is the lyrics screen of a karaoke app; the song is only one line long, a few tens of seconds.
As the accompaniment began, the cursor on the lyrics screen started moving, and then Li Wanyin's singing voice floated out.
What to do on a rainy day?
[I miss you so much--]
[I don't dare call you - I can't find a reason]
……
Chen Shi'an didn't fast forward a single second; he just listened to the song clip, which was several tens of seconds long, with the speakers on, right in front of Li Wanyin.
"Sister Wanyin sings very well."
Chen Shi'an praised him sincerely.
Although he rarely listens to these pop songs, he has an excellent ear for music and never picks and chooses songs.
He had never heard of the original singer of this song. The first time he heard it was sung by Li Wanyin, and he really thought it was sung quite well. Li Wanyin's gentle and melodious voice was indeed a perfect match for this type of song.
"..."
Faced with his praise, the older sister beside him seemed deaf and showed no reaction whatsoever.
She looked down at the training materials in her hands, and only occasionally, when the floor fan mischievously blew a strand of hair across her cheek, did her already red ears and pretty face become visible.
"Who is Wanyin thinking of on this rainy day?"
"...That's just lyrics! It's definitely not true! Duh!"
Upon hearing Chen Shi'an's words, Li Wanyin, whose face was already flushed with embarrassment, quickly retorted, fearing that he would continue to misunderstand.
Singing has always been her hobby, but she rarely sings in front of others; she just plays around with karaoke apps and such.
Later, when Douyin (TikTok) came out, she also tried posting some of her recordings and screen recordings from karaoke apps on it. They were all like this piece, without showing her face. Occasionally, someone would like or comment on them, which made her quite happy. She treated it as a form of entertainment.
In fact, this field is ridiculously competitive. There are many good-looking people and many good singers. You really can't become popular without some other means.
Li Wanyin strongly disliked this approach; she preferred to earn money honestly and practically.
Therefore, she has never shown her face online, and even though she has changed her profile picture on WeChat, she hasn't changed her Douyin profile picture either.
Chen Shi'an continued to look at the other works on Li Wanyin's account. They were all recordings and screen recordings from karaoke software, with some having hundreds of likes and others only a dozen or so. They were all purely singing and sharing.
Several frequently appearing IDs in the comments section posted exaggerated comments such as: "[It's so good! I love it! [Lewd][Lewd]]"
But Li Wanyin only replied to these few IDs, and her replies were either some equally exaggerated emojis or a string of ellipses.
Chen Shi'an clicked on those IDs and looked at them. They were all female, and the addresses were all local.
I guess she's a good friend of Sister Wanyin.
Li Wanyin's likes list was not closed. Chen Shi'an took a look and saw that his sister usually liked to like cute pet videos, some amazing transition videos, movie reviews, secret adventure videos, and so on.
Chen Shi'an watched with great interest, while Li Wanyin was so embarrassed that she didn't want to talk to him anymore.
After listening to a few songs at random, Chen Shi'an finally exited her personal interface. In his own following list, [Xiao Huiyin] became the first person he followed on Douyin, just like on WeChat, and the two of them also showed a mutual following interaction icon.
Li Wanyin breathed a sigh of relief when she finally heard her singing stop coming from his phone. She was so embarrassed.
I'll listen to the rest of the songs when I have time.
"...It's okay if you're not available."
"Sister Wanyin hasn't released a new song in a long time."
"I've been so busy lately, how could I have time to sing..."
After feeling embarrassed for half the night, the older sister finally sighed with the wisdom of someone who's been there: "Let's focus on making money first before thinking about hobbies. It's getting late, time for bed!"
After saying that, Li Wanyin got up from the sofa and went back to her room.
She closed the door, sat on the edge of the bed, quickly opened Douyin (TikTok), turned off the like list, deleted the songs... Oh well, she'll just listen to them.

Twelve o'clock in the evening.
An hour after the lights in room 901 had been turned off, Wen Zhixia finally put down her pen and put the test paper into her backpack.
Like a drunkard, she swayed and limply fell onto the bed.
With a small touch, she turned off the bedside lamp.
Another light shone on her phone screen, reflecting off her small face.
Even when I'm really tired, I always have to use my phone before bed, even if it's just for a few minutes.
There's been no news from WeChat.
Open Douyin.
The video of Chen Shi'an making pine nut candy that he had just posted popped up.
She had been secretly following Chen Shi'an on Douyin for a long time, but she hadn't told him that she had left a comment on the video of Baduanjin that Teacher Wan posted.
[The first thing to do is to make the syrup...]
In the video, Chen Shi'an was making pine nut candy, and she has now eaten it. She didn't expect that this stinky Taoist priest would also make a video of himself making pine nut candy.
Watching him make pine nut candy in bed like this was a wonderful feeling. Wen Zhixia perked up and decided to watch the whole video before going to sleep.
She was so sleepy that she didn't even think about who had filmed the video for her.
[You continue! I'll record a video so I can learn to do it myself later...]
The sudden appearance of a female voice in the video dispelled some of Wen Zhixia's drowsiness.
It's a very pleasant and gentle voice.
Wen Zhixia rubbed her eyes, propped herself up, and swiped the progress bar to rewind the video and listen to the woman's voice again.
Wow! It smells so good!
Whose voice?
The girl was alert for a moment, then her sleepy mind finally came to its senses... Oh! His roommate!
You scared me...
I thought it was Lin Mengqiu...
Wen Zhixia lay back down.
After watching the video, she swiped to the left and went to Chen Shi'an's homepage.
She had already liked the photos Chen Shi'an posted this morning of hiking, and she also liked the video just now.
Look at that stinky Taoist priest's fans, he's got almost nine thousand already...
Huh?
When did he get a new follower?
Wen Zhixia clicked into Chen Shi'an's list of followers and saw a user named [Little Echo].
Following the trail, she clicked into Xiao Huiyin's account to take a look.
My favorites list is locked, but there are still quite a few Douyin videos on it.
Xiao Huiyin has very few fans, only a little over a thousand, and her videos get very few likes, so she is clearly not an internet celebrity.
Could it be Lin Mengqiu?
Wen Zhixia randomly clicked on a work.
Beautiful singing voice.
A familiar voice...
That sounds so familiar! That sounds so familiar!
Ah! It's Chen Shi'an's roommate!
Comparing the audio in Wen Zhixia's two videos, this little echo is none other than Chen Shi'an's roommate!
Unfortunately, she searched through Xiao Huiyin's account thoroughly but couldn't find any selfies or everyday photos. Judging from common sense about surfing the internet, people who don't show their faces are probably not good-looking...
However, it seems that the stinky Taoist priest and his roommate have a pretty good relationship; she helps him film videos and they follow each other on social media...
The girl's big eyes darted around.
Recalling what Chen Shi'an said—[He's about four or five years older than us, and he's already graduated and working]
Well……
Nothing happened.
I'm so sleepy! Time for bed!
With her heavy eyelids finally closing, she tossed her phone onto the pillow, burrowed into the covers, and fell fast asleep…
……
A teacher's dormitory at midnight.
Lin Mengqiu, who had just finished a day of studying, was eating pine nut candy while watching the video that Chen Shi'an had just posted on Douyin.
You know what, the pine nut candy in my hand tastes even better when eaten with this video.
While eating, she made the same voyeuristic gesture as Wen Zhixia.
When she saw that the little echo was not Wen Zhixia, but Chen Shi'an's roommate, she felt relieved.
Anyway, Chen Shi'an didn't know which account she used.
So Lin Mengqiu, who never liked anyone's posts, gave him a thumbs up.
After liking it, he also left a comment:
[Pine nut candy is really delicious! So good! So good!]
